This is a drug label for a bottle of acetaminophen pain reliever/fever reducer tablets made by Akr&/n Pharma. It contains 1000 tablets, with 325 mg of acetaminophen in each tablet, and the label states that it is aspirin free. The medication is indicated to temporarily relieve minor aches and pains such as headaches, menstrual cramps, muscular aches, and minor arthritis pain, as well as to temporarily reduce fever. The drug must not be used with other medicines containing acetaminophen, and individuals who have had an allergic reaction to the product or any of its ingredients should not use it. Also, the label warns that severe liver damage may occur if the adult takes more than 4,000 mg of acetaminophen in 24 hours, a child takes more than five doses in 24 hours, or it is taken with other drugs containing acetaminophen. The packaging is child-resistant, and users must not take more than directed. The label also includes information on overdose warning, allergies, and instructions on how to administer the drug to different age groups.*

This is a drug label for Acetaminophen Regular Strength Tablet, manufactured by AkrJn Pharma in the USA. Each tablet contains 325 mg of acetaminophen and is an aspirin-free pain reliever/fever reducer that can temporarily reduce fever and relieve minor aches and pains such as headache, muscular aches, backache, and minor arthritis pain. The label cautions not to use the medicine with other medicines containing acetaminophen or if the user has hypersensitivity to the acetaminophen or any of the inactive ingredients. Moreover, the warning indicates that severe liver damage could occur if the drug is used more than the recommended dose. It is also recommended to stop using the drug if the severity of pain lasts more than ten days in adults and five days in children, or if a new symptom occurs. If a skin reaction occurs, the use of the drug should be stopped and medical help should be immediately sought.*

This is a drug facts label for a regular strength acetaminophen tablet that temporarily reduces fever and relieves minor aches and pains due to headaches, muscular aches, backaches, minor pain of arthritis, common cold, toothaches, premenstrual and menstrual cramps. The label warns that severe liver damage may occur if an adult takes more than 4,000 mg of acetaminophen in 24 hours or a child takes more than 5 doses in 24 hours or if taken with other drugs containing acetaminophen or if an adult has 3 or more alcoholic drinks every day while using the product. It also warns that acetaminophen may cause severe skin reactions and advises customers to stop use and seek medical help right away if this occurs. The drug should not be used if allergic to acetaminophen or any of its inactive ingredients. The label outlines dosage instructions based on age groups and includes other information such as inactive ingredients in the drug, storage recommendations, and contact details for the manufacturer.*
